Answer:

The y-intercept is 9.

Step-by-step explanation:

The slope-intercept form of a linear equation has the following form.

y = mx + b

where

y is the dependent variable

m is the slope

x is the independent variable

b is the y-intercept

Given the following equation

y = x + 9

The slope is 1 and the y-intercept is 9.
